IF DANGER IS WHAT MOTIVATES YOUR SPORTING INTEREST...
June 26, 2006 - 08:35

You might want to take up basketball. That's right, basketball may be the most dangerous sport in America, at least if you go by emergency room visits. Meanwhile, the 47,000 golfers who hurt themselves enough to end up in the emergency room deserve a special brand of pity. CLICK HERE.
